What Is an Incident Response Platform and Why Is It Essential?
An Incident Response Platform is a sophisticated, integrated system designed to manage security incidents and operational threats within an organization. It functions as the nerve center for cybersecurity protocols, enabling businesses to react swiftly and decisively when faced with threats such as data breaches, malware attacks, or system failures.
Implementing such a platform into your IT services & computer repair and security systems infrastructure is not merely an option—it's a necessity for maintaining integrity, trust, and competitive edge in a hyper-connected world. The Incident Response Platform acts as a comprehensive hub that consolidates detection, analysis, containment, eradication, recovery, and post-incident review activities into a streamlined process.

The Crucial Role of Security Systems in Modern Business Ecosystems
Securing your business environment goes beyond traditional firewalls and antivirus software. An Incident Response Platform integrates with various security systems to form a cohesive defensive architecture, comprising:
- Network Intrusion Detection Systems (IDS): Monitoring traffic for suspicious activities.
- Firewall Management: Enforcing access controls and filtering malicious data.
- Endpoint Detection and Response (EDR): Protecting individual devices from threats.
- Security Information and Event Management (SIEM): Collecting and analyzing security alerts for a holistic view.
By unifying these components within an Incident Response Platform, organizations can achieve a proactive security stance, reducing the likelihood of successful attacks and ensuring swift action when threats are detected.
Features to Look for in an Effective Incident Response Platform
To maximize benefits, select an Incident Response Platform that encompasses the following features:
- Real-Time Incident Detection: Continuous monitoring to catch threats early.
- Automated Playbooks: Predefined procedures for rapid response actions.
- Centralized Dashboard: Unified view of security alerts, incidents, and responses.
- Case Management: Effective tracking and documentation of incidents for analysis.
- Threat Intelligence Integration: Up-to-date insights to inform response strategies.
- Collaboration Tools: Facilitate communication among security, IT, and management teams.
- Reporting and Compliance: Generate detailed reports for audits and regulatory reporting.

The Future of Incident Response and Business Security
As cyber threats become increasingly sophisticated, the importance of an Incident Response Platform will only grow. Emerging trends include:
- Artificial Intelligence and Machine Learning: Enhancing detection accuracy and automating complex responses.
- Integrative Threat Intelligence Sharing: Collaborating across organizations to identify and mitigate threats faster.
- Extended Detection and Response (XDR): Providing unified security across all platforms, endpoints, and cloud services.
- Automated Response Orchestration: Coordinating responses across multiple systems for swift containment.
